Neuros Medical, Inc., a medical device company announced the expansion of their Clinical Advisory Board with the additions of two leading experts in the field of chronic pain, Dr. Salim Hayek and Dr. Leonardo Kapural. They join current members Dr. Michael Stanton-Hicks of Cleveland Clinic and Dr. Amol Soin of the Ohio Pain Clinic, who has chaired the Clinical Advisory Board since its formation.

Dr. Hayek is currently the Chief of the Division of Pain Medicine at University Hospitals of Cleveland and Professor in the Department of Anesthesiology at Case Western Reserve University. He obtained a BSc degree in Biology with Distinction at the American University of Beirut in 1987 and MD degree in 1991. Following a residency in Anesthesiology training at University Hospitals, he completed a PhD in Cellular Physiology at Case Western Reserve University in 2000 and subsequently obtained fellowship training in Pain Medicine at Cleveland Clinic. He is well published and serves on the editorial board for most pain journals. Dr. Hayek has had a number of service accomplishments at the local and national levels including the Board of Directors, North American Neuromodulation Society and the Council of Pain Physician Societies. “I feel the Neuros technology is one of the most exciting therapies in development for the treatment of chronic pain,” said Dr. Hayek.

Dr. Leonardo Kapural is the Clinical Director, Wake Forest University Health Sciences Center Chronic Pain Center, Carolinas Pain Institute and Center for Clinical Research. He is also Professor of Anesthesiology, Wake Forest University, School of Medicine. Dr. Kapural earned a medical degree and a doctorate of philosophy at the University of Zagreb, School of Medicine in the Republic of Croatia. He completed Research Fellowships at McGill University and University of Connecticut, Farmington, CT. He completed residency at the Cleveland Clinic's Division of Anesthesiology and Critical Care and Fellowship in Pain Management at the Cleveland Clinic. He is an active member of the American Academy of Pain Medicine, International Association for the Study of Pain, International Spine Intervention Society, American Neuromodulation Society and World Institute of Pain. Dr. Kapural's noteworthy research findings have been published in more than 70 journal articles, more than 70 abstracts, and 20 book chapters. He is listed by his peers in the "Best Doctors in America". “I am pleased to join Neuros Medical in this advisory role and feel their therapy has strong potential in a wide range of chronic pain conditions,” he said.

Neuros Medical, a Cleveland, Ohio based neuromodulation company, is focused on developing proprietary therapies for unmet needs to patients worldwide. The Company’s patented platform technology, Electrical Nerve Block, is focused on the elimination of chronic pain in a variety of conditions including amputation pain, post-surgical pain, migraine, and trigeminal neuralgia.
